Abstract

This paper attempts to expose the workings of patriarchy in subjugating women with reference to Sister of My Heart (1999) and The Vine of Desire (2003) authored by Chitra Banerjee Divakaruni. The paper traces the ups and downs in the lives of two distant cousins, Sudha and Anju. Their lives follow a circular pattern of union, separation and reunion. Divakaruni's Sister of my Heart and The Vine of Desire depict the coming of age of two sisters in a highly patriarchal society. Though there are several similarities between Sister of My Heart and The Vine of Desire, there is a great deal of stylistic variation between the two which merit serious study and analysis.
